About Audi A6 Spark Plugs Parts
Ensure reliable ignition with quality spark plugs for your Audi A6. Spark plugs ignite the air-fuel mixture in your engine cylinders. Replace them according to your vehicle's maintenance schedule for optimal performance and fuel economy.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I find the right spark plugs for my Audi A6?
Verify compatibility using your Audi A6's VIN number, production year (2019-2024), and engine code. Check seller compatibility charts and cross-reference OEM part numbers when possible.
How often should I replace spark plugs on my Audi A6?
General guideline: Copper: 30,000 miles, Platinum: 60,000 miles, Iridium: 100,000 miles. However, driving conditions (city vs highway, climate, towing) affect replacement frequency. Inspect regularly and replace when warning signs appear.
Should I use OEM or aftermarket spark plugs for my Audi A6?
OEM parts guarantee exact Audi specifications and fitment. Quality aftermarket brands often meet or exceed OEM standards at lower prices. For warranty vehicles, check if aftermarket parts affect coverage.
What are signs that my Audi A6 needs new spark plugs?
Common warning signs include: Rough idle, Misfires, Poor acceleration, Increased fuel consumption, Hard starting. If you notice any of these symptoms, inspect or replace the spark plugs promptly to prevent further damage.
